News Shooter (Today) - Hasselblad has announced its new X2D II 100C, which features AF-C continuous autofocus, Hasselblad Natural Colour Solution with High Dynamic Range, 10 stops of stabilization, and Phocus Mobile 2. The X2D II 100C is claimed to be the industry’s first 100-megapixel medium format camera with true end-to-end high dynamic range (HDR).
